On May 29, 1993, a racist arson attack shook Solingen. Now, 31 years later, it is time to make the often overlooked voices of the survivors, their family members and other victims of racist violence heard.

We cordially invite you to the commemorative event and discussion, in which we will not only let those affected have their say, but also offer academic analyses, reflections and discussions. Together we want to discuss questions about the origins of racist terror and the options for action in the context of combating racism.

In cooperation with the alliance Tag der Solidarität - Kein Schlussstrich Dortmund, we are setting an example against forgetting and for a world without racist violence.
